Stop AI scrapers from hammering your self-hosted blog Capabilities
Analyzes incoming HTTP requests to identify AI scraper patterns by examining user-agent strings, request headers, timing patterns, and access sequences. Uses heuristic matching against known scraper signatures (GPTBot, CCBot, etc.) combined with behavioral analysis of request frequency and resource access patterns to distinguish legitimate traffic from automated crawlers without requiring IP blocklists or rate limiting.

Intercepts HTTP responses destined for detected scraper bots and injects alternative content (specifically adult/NSFW material) that serves as a honeypot signal without blocking legitimate traffic. The injection happens at the middleware layer before response transmission, allowing the server to serve normal content to legitimate users while feeding scrapers with content that degrades training data quality or triggers scraper filtering mechanisms.

Maintains and matches incoming request user-agent strings against a database of known AI scraper identifiers (GPTBot, CCBot, Anthropic-AI, etc.). Uses string pattern matching to identify requests from common AI training crawlers, search engine bots, and known scraper tools. The signature database can be updated to include new scraper patterns as they emerge.
